These severe gusts push melting cinders right into little voids in roof, soffits, and wall surface assemblies. Standard structure layouts commonly feature subjected eaves or vulnerable home siding materials that catch fire when coal collect. Solidifying the outside shell acts as the main line of protection versus these wind-driven wildfire risks.What Duty Do Local Fire Security Codes Play in Home Improvement?Local building regulations determine specific performance standards for outside materials, roofing system settings up, and home window glass strength to prevent structural ignition. Top-quality tile, slate, standing-seam steel, and concrete roof covering assemblies quit warmth transfer successfully. Property owners have to guarantee service providers seal all roof side spaces with non-combustible bird quits or steel flashing. Getting rid of open spaces under roofing floor tiles stops wind-driven cinders from getting in the underlying roofing structure.Exactly How Does Siding Option Avoid Thermal Warm Transfer?Non-combustible exterior siding develops a robust obstacle that reflects high induction heat and resists straight flames. Materials such as thick conventional stucco, concrete panels, and high-density fiber concrete do not fire up when revealed to intense thermal radiation. Mounting an underlying fire-resistant sheath underneath the key exterior siding includes a crucial second protection layer. This multi-layered exterior wall surface approach keeps interior architectural framework safe throughout intense heat direct exposure.Modern Architectural Particulars That Block Flying EmbersRefining refined building details eliminates hidden collection factors where wind-blown coal generally gather during a wildfire. Specialty vents featuring fine mesh screening block embers while keeping essential attic room air flow. These corrosion-resistant steel screens stop particles as tiny as one-sixteenth of an inch from getting in learn more inner attic room areas. Upgrading outside air flow points safeguards covert roof rooms from inner ignition.What Doors And Window Features Resist Extreme Heat Direct Exposure?Dual-pane home windows geared up with tempered outside glass withstand fracturing under serious heat stress better than conventional annealed glass. Multi-pane home window settings up keep induction heat from sparking indoor home window treatments or furniture. Strong fire-rated exterior doors including durable weather removing block draft pathways that could draw coal into living locations. Choosing enhanced metal or fiberglass door structures makes sure structural stability throughout thermal events.Developing Defensible Area in Coastal Residential SetupsEstablishing defensible room around a Santa Monica home reduces direct fire exposure and lessens readily available fuel near the main house. The instant five-foot boundary must continue to be entirely free of combustible mulch, wooden fence, or dense plants. The second protection area, expanding thirty feet from the home, calls for low-growing plants, well-irrigated lawn, and extensively spaced trees. Removing dead organic matter continuously keeps gas degrees marginal throughout both areas.Which Indigenous Plant Kingdoms Assistance Fire Resistance and Coastal Appeal?Fire-retardant plants include high dampness material, reduced sap volume, and very little leaf shedding throughout seasonal climate changes. Variety such as agave, delicious ranges, California lilac, and deep-rooted groundcovers soak up warmth without sparking swiftly. Preventing resinous plants like eucalyptus, yearn, and ornamental grasses protects against quick flame spread near living locations.
